According to our (Global Info Research) latest study, the global Enclosed Ground Flares market size was valued at US$ 337 million in 2025 and is forecast to a readjusted size of US$ 470 million by 2032 with a CAGR of 4.8% during review period.
Enclosed Ground Flares are ground-level industrial flare systems in which burner heads are installed inside an insulated or refractory-lined combustion chamber, allowing waste gases to be combusted with reduced visible flame, lower noise, lower ground-level heat radiation, and better wind protection than open flares. They are commonly used in refineries, petrochemical plants, gas processing facilities, LNG plants, chemical plants, landfills, biogas/RNG projects, and industrial sites where visual impact, noise, safety distance, and emission control are important.
In 2025, global Enclosed Ground Flares production reached approximately 556 units, with an average global market price of around US$ 590,000 per unit.
The upstream supply chain includes carbon steel and stainless steel materials, refractory lining, low-emission burners, flare tips, pilots, ignition systems, gas headers, knockout drums, seal drums, valves, blowers or draft-control devices, PLC control panels, flame scanners, temperature instruments, pressure instruments, and emission-monitoring components. Midstream suppliers design, fabricate, integrate, install, commission, and maintain complete enclosed ground flare systems. Downstream customers mainly include refineries, petrochemical complexes, oil and gas facilities, gas processing plants, LNG terminals, chemical plants, landfills, wastewater treatment plants, biogas projects, RNG facilities, tank farms, and industrial parks.
The cost structure of enclosed ground flares mainly consists of the refractory-lined combustion chamber, burner and flare-tip system, structural steel enclosure, ignition and pilot system, gas distribution manifold, draft or air-control system, control and safety instrumentation, knockout and liquid-separation equipment, engineering design, fabrication, transportation, installation, commissioning, and maintenance. Systems with higher combustion efficiency, staged burner control, low-noise design, low-emission burners, higher temperature rating, larger gas capacity, and stricter monitoring requirements have higher costs because they require more advanced combustion design, refractory materials, automation, and site engineering.
